The Growing Data Dilemma for UK SMEs

Understanding the Stakes

The digital transformation journey has empowered UK SMEs to operate efficiently and reach wider audiences. According to statistics, 77% of SMEs in the UK consider data as a crucial asset. However, a staggering 60% of small businesses that experience a data loss will shut down within six months. This alarming statistic underscores the urgency of having a solid backup strategy in place.

Common Pain Points

  1. Cybersecurity Threats: With the rise of ransomware and phishing attacks, SMEs are increasingly targeted due to their often limited security measures. A successful attack can lead to irreversible data loss or significant financial penalties.

  2. Hardware Failures: Hard drives fail, servers crash, and systems malfunction; these realities can lead to unexpected data loss if not properly managed.

  1. Human Error: Accidental deletions, incorrect file modifications, and mismanagement can compromise data integrity, leading to potentially catastrophic outcomes.
  1. Natural Disasters: Floods, fires, and other unforeseen disasters can physically damage IT infrastructure, resulting in data loss that could have been prevented with an effective backup strategy.

  2. Compliance Risks: Many SMEs must adhere to data protection regulations like the GDPR. Failure to protect data can lead to hefty fines and a loss of customer trust.

Essential Backup Solutions for UK SMEs

Cloud Backup Solutions

Cloud technology has revolutionized how businesses store and manage their data. For SMEs in the UK, leveraging cloud backup solutions can provide an effective and affordable way to safeguard data.

Advantages of Cloud Backup

  • Scalability: As your business grows, so does your data. Cloud backup solutions can easily scale to accommodate increased data storage needs without requiring significant capital investment in hardware.

  • Accessibility: Cloud-based backups enable employees to access data from anywhere, fostering remote work and flexibility.

  • Cost-Effectiveness: With a pay-as-you-go model, SMEs can avoid the high upfront costs associated with traditional backup solutions.

  • Automatic Backups: Most cloud services offer automated backup options, ensuring that your data is regularly updated without manual intervention.

Recommended Cloud Solutions

  • Microsoft Azure: Offers a comprehensive set of services for data backup and recovery, suitable for businesses of all sizes.
  • Google Cloud Storage: An affordable and scalable solution that integrates seamlessly with other Google services.

  • AWS Backup: Provides centralized backup management and automated backup solutions across AWS services.

Cybersecurity Measures

While having a backup solution is critical, it is equally important to secure your data from threats. Cybersecurity measures are essential in ensuring that your backup data remains uncompromised.

Key Cybersecurity Practices

  • Firewalls and Anti-Virus Software: Invest in robust firewalls and regularly updated anti-virus software to protect against malware and unauthorized access.
  • Encryption: Encrypting data both in transit and at rest ensures that even if data is intercepted, it cannot be read without the appropriate keys.
  • Regular Security Audits: Conduct routine audits to identify vulnerabilities within your IT infrastructure and implement necessary fixes.

  • Employee Training: Educate employees on the importance of cybersecurity, including how to recognize phishing attempts and other common threats.

Managed IT Services

For many SMEs, managing IT operations can be overwhelming, especially with limited resources. Managed IT services provide a comprehensive approach to handling IT needs, including data backup and cybersecurity.

Benefits of Managed IT Services

  • Expertise on Demand: Access to a team of IT professionals with specialized knowledge in data protection, allowing you to focus on your core business functions.

  • Proactive Monitoring: Continuous monitoring of your IT systems helps identify and mitigate potential issues before they escalate into significant problems.

  • Customized Solutions: Managed IT providers can tailor their services to meet your specific business needs and challenges.

  • Cost Predictability: With a fixed monthly fee, managed IT services can help SMEs budget more effectively for their IT needs.

Choosing the Right Backup Solution

When selecting a backup solution, consider the following factors:

  • Business Size and Type: Identify solutions that suit your business’s specific needs, whether you’re a startup or a more established SME.

  • Compliance Requirements: Ensure that your chosen solution meets any industry-specific regulations regarding data protection.

  • Ease of Use: Look for user-friendly solutions that require minimal training and can be easily integrated into existing workflows.

  • Customer Support: Opt for providers known for excellent customer service to ensure prompt assistance when needed.
